Sultanpur is an inhabited village in Mahanga Tahasil of Cuttack district, Odisha. Its Census village code is 399498, the Census 2011 record lists 165 people in 45 households and the reported area is 19 hectares. The local references include Jaleswarpur Gram Panchayat, Mahanga CD Block and the nearest town reference is Cuttack at about 44 km.

These Census 2011 identifiers place Sultanpur in the official administrative record. Census village code 399498, Jaleswarpur Gram Panchayat and Mahanga CD Block.
Cuttack is the nearest town listed for Sultanpur, about 44 km away. Cuttack is listed as the district headquarters at about 44 km. These distances are useful for orientation, not for survey, boundary or emergency use.
The Census 2011 record lists 165 people in 45 households, with 81 male residents and 84 female residents. The average household size is 3.67, and SC share is 4.85% and ST share is 0% for Sultanpur. Population density works out to about 868.42 people per sq km.
Education entries for Sultanpur list 1 government primary school. Counts come from the village facility record and may need local verification for current school status.
Drinking-water and sanitation entries for Sultanpur include hand pump water. These are historical facility records, not a live water-quality guarantee.
Connectivity records for Sultanpur include mobile phone coverage and all-weather road access. Use them as access clues and confirm present conditions locally.
Public-service entries for Sultanpur include self-help groups and ASHA services. Banking rows on this page are shown separately because they use RBI-sourced bank service records.
Domestic power supply for Sultanpur is reported as 15 hours per day in summer and 20 hours per day in winter. Treat this as historical Census/District Census Handbook data.
Land-use records for Sultanpur show that reported agricultural commodities include Paddy, Pulses and Jute, net sown area is 12.99 hectares and irrigated land is 12.39 hectares (95.4% of net sown area). These figures help explain village agriculture and local economy context.
